Indian Army announces a tender for Line Small Epabx, Operator Console, Pair MDF Box Original Crone Plat Original Crone Make Module, Digital Grounding Device Single Phase with MIL STD JSS 55555, Float cum boost charger for EPABX Sys item description Current rating 25A Voltage Rating 48V with Bty Bank 12v26ah 1x4, Installation and Commissioning Charges, E1 ISDN PRI CEPT Card one Port each, GSM Card for four Port GSM SIM 4G Support, Radio Interface Card RIC four Port with Software Cables and connectors for VHF HF UHF Radios, CLI with Speaker phone Beetel Make M59 in WEST DELHI, DELHI.
